Mindanao, Visayas & Luzon Cultural Celebrations
Popular celebrations include:
- Mindanao: Kadayawan, Tโnalak
- Visayas: Sinulog, Dinagyang
- Luzon: Panagbenga, Pahiyas

Trend #4: Filipino Cuisine Acting as a Cultural Language
Food as the Easiest Way to Understand Filipino Traditions
Food is the quickest way to grasp Filipino traditionsโadobo reveals historical influence, sinigang shows comfort culture, and lechon highlights community celebrations.
Rise of Filipino Chefs and Bloggers Abroad
Filipino restaurants worldwide have become cultural ambassadors, helping foreigners understand dish origins and food customs.
Dishes That Reflect Filipino Traditions
- Sinigang โ comfort & family warmth
- Lechon โ festive gatherings
- Bibingka โ Christmas traditions
- Kinilaw โ pre-colonial roots
- Inasal โ community culture

Trend #6: Filipino Traditions Highlighted Through Wellness, Rituals & Local Crafts
Wellness Practices from Indigenous Roots
Traditional wellness practicesโhilot, herbal medicine, and cleansing ritualsโare returning in popularity as people seek natural, mindful lifestyles. Many travelers also explore these practices to reduce anxiety and improve stress management.
Sustainable Crafts Preserving Filipino Traditions
Artisans revive:
- Handwoven fabrics
- Natural dyeing
- Wood carvings
- Bamboo crafts
